Dream Meaning of Purple

Dream Meaning of Purple

In the world of dreams, purple carries a dual message: it is a color of triumph and high standing, yet it also draws attention to the emotional side of your decisions. Dream interpreters generally see it as a sign that a run of bad luck is ending and that you are moving toward a position of respect, wealth, or public recognition. At the same time, purple asks you to look honestly at your feelings, because the specific objects that appear in your dream shape the exact meaning.

Seeing the color purple generally

If you simply see purple in your dream, without any particular object attached, it is usually considered a fortunate sign. Sources speak of it as marking the end of repeated failures and the beginning of a smoother path. It also stands for prestige, authority, and the kind of reputation that makes others look up to you. Some old interpretations add a note of caution: purple can reflect doubt or uncertainty in certain matters, so take time to verify facts before making major decisions.

Wearing purple clothes

Dreaming that you put on purple clothing suggests that your intelligence and distinctive qualities will help you stand out in your career. You may be offered a position of responsibility, or you may gain admiration from colleagues who secretly envy your success. On a personal level, wearing purple also points to romantic courage: if there is someone you have been afraid to open up to, you will soon find the confidence to confess your feelings, and they are likely to be returned.

Seeing purple objects or fabrics

Purple objects, fabrics, or decorations in a dream point to a life of luxury and comfort. The traditional meaning is that you are destined for a prosperous household, with more than enough money to support your family and enjoy fine things. This is a very positive image, but it also reminds you not to let your emotional nature cloud your judgment. If you are facing an important choice, try to balance your heart with practical reasoning.

Purple flowers, especially roses

Purple flowers, particularly roses, are linked to love and generosity. If you see a purple rose, it may mean that you have been kind to others and that your good deeds will return to you many times over. It can also be a sign that a love confession is near, and that the person you adore will respond with deep affection. For those starting a new job, purple flowers suggest a comfortable environment where money comes easily and you can enjoy a relaxed, affluent lifestyle.

Purple fruits like plums and grapes

Seeing purple grapes or plums is one of the most auspicious dreams in this tradition. It promises an increase in wealth, multiple pieces of good news, and a fortunate period in your life. If you are single, marriage may be on the horizon; if you are looking for work, a good job will come your way. These fruits also represent security, meaning you will be able to guarantee a comfortable future for yourself and your loved ones.

Purple vegetables, such as cabbage

Purple cabbage appears in dreams as a warning about your words and temper. The sources say you may say something that causes serious trouble, leading to arguments among family members or conflicts at work. This is a reminder to pause before speaking and to consider how your words affect the people you care about. If you have been feeling irritable, the dream advises you to find a calm way to express your frustrations.

A purple snake

A purple snake is an unusual but powerful symbol. It represents people who wish you harm, especially those who hide their envy behind a friendly mask. The good news is that these scheming individuals are likely to fall into their own trap. Your task is to stay alert and rely on trustworthy friends; the dream assures you that their plans will not succeed against you.

Body parts turning purple (bruises)

If you dream that your body or part of it is turning purple, the traditional interpretation is that you will receive money soon. This might seem strange, but it is a long-standing folk meaning: the discoloration represents a transfer of wealth into your hands. It does not suggest an injury; rather, it points to a financial gain arriving unexpectedly.

As with any dream symbol, the exact details matter. Purple consistently carries themes of status, wealth, and emotional truth, but the variations you see—whether a flower, a fruit, a garment, or a warning image—tell you where to focus your attention. Trust the positive direction this color points to, but keep your eyes open for the deceits it sometimes reveals.
